Police Arraign Businessman For Shielding Offender
The police in
Gwagwalada have arraigned a businessman, Chukwuemeka Abagaradu, 66, in a Senior Magistrate Court for shielding an offender.
The Police Prosecutor, Insp. Gabriel Ndulue, told the court that the accused was arraigned for not being able to produce his son.
Joseph, whom he stood surety for sometime in September.
Ndulue said that Joseph who was store keeper at a company, Ndupu Enterprises Ltd., in Gwagwalada was on September 13 accused of stealing N1.8 million from the company.
He said that the matter was lodged at the Gwagwalada Police Station by one Mr Chidi Ndupu on September 19.
Abagaradu, who resides in New Kutunku in Gwagwalada, pleaded not guilty to the charge.
The Magistrate, Mr Ahmed Adajiowo, admitted the accused to bail in the sum of N400,000 with two sureties in like sum.
Ndajowo ordered that the sureties must reside within the FCT and must be civil servants or have landed property.
He ordered the sureties to attach their passport photographs to the bail bond.
Ndajowo adjourned the case to November 4 for hearing.
